Chess Structures: A Grandmaster Guide, Chess Structures: A Grandmaster Guide
This is the definitive modern masterpiece on middlegame strategy. Flores Ríos breaks the game down into 28 pawn structures. He bypasses the fluff to teach you the exact plans, piece placements, and risks associated with each skeleton. The model games are brilliantly selected to isolate the structural themes without getting bogged down in messy tactical anomalies. It is an absolute must-read that completely reshapes how you look at the board. Personally, I learnt through the chessable course, where it is narrated by Peter Heine-Nielsen.
